Creality 3D 3301030036 PETG Blue is a 1 kg spool of polyethylene terephthalate glycol-modified (PETG) filament with a diameter of 1.75 mm. Designed for use with Creality 3D printers and compatible models, this blue PETG filament combines strong layer adhesion and dimensional stability to produce durable parts with minimal warping. The material balances toughness and printability, making it suitable for functional prototypes, mechanical components, and aesthetic models where impact resistance and a smooth finish are required.
PETG provides superior layer bonding and is less likely to delaminate compared with some other commonly used filaments. Its composition offers a good compromise between the rigidity of PLA and the toughness of ABS, delivering higher impact resistance while remaining easier to print than high-temperature engineering plastics. The 1.75 mm diameter ensures consistent extrusion on most desktop FDM printers, and the 1 kg spool provides a practical quantity for small to medium-sized projects.
Load the 1.75 mm PETG filament into the printer according to the printer manufacturer's instructions. Set the hotend temperature and bed temperature following recommended PETG ranges for your specific machine; typical starting points are around 230–250°C for the nozzle and 60–80°C for the heated bed, but verify with your printer and adjust by ±5–10°C as needed. Use a moderate print speed and enable retraction settings appropriate for PETG to reduce stringing. Ensure the first layer adheres well by calibrating bed leveling and adjusting Z-offset. Allow parts to cool gradually to avoid internal stress.
Store the filament in a dry environment or sealed container with desiccant to maintain print quality. If filament has absorbed moisture, dry according to filament manufacturer guidelines before printing. When printing functional parts, consider adding additional infill or thicker walls to improve strength, and test small samples to fine-tune temperature, speed, and cooling settings for optimal surface finish and mechanical properties.
